Le lien potentiel entre la mise en œuvre multilingue des fichiers HTML et le développement du domaine mobile
한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ina
Tout d’abord, examinons les concepts et principes de base de la génération multilingue de fichiers HTML. HTML est le langage d'architecture de base des pages Web. La génération multilingue signifie que la même page Web peut fournir un affichage de contenu précis et approprié pour les utilisateurs de différentes langues. Cela nécessite non seulement une compréhension approfondie de la grammaire et du vocabulaire de diverses langues, mais nécessite également l'utilisation habile des technologies d'encodage et de balisage pertinentes.
D'un point de vue technique, réaliser une génération multilingue de fichiers HTML implique de nombreux liens. Par exemple, le réglage correct du codage des caractères est essentiel pour garantir que les caractères dans différentes langues peuvent être affichés avec précision. Les méthodes de codage courantes telles que UTF-8 peuvent prendre en charge presque tous les caractères de langue, fournissant ainsi une base solide pour la prise en charge multilingue. De plus, une utilisation raisonnable deL'attribut `charset` dans la balise `spécifie clairement la méthode de codage, ce qui peut efficacement éviter le problème de l'affichage anormal des caractères.
La conception et l'organisation des bases de données sont également cruciales en matière de gestion de contenu. Pour le contenu multilingue, les champs de langue correspondants doivent être définis pour stocker et récupérer avec précision les informations dans différentes versions linguistiques. Dans le même temps, dans le développement Web dynamique, grâce à des langages de programmation back-end tels que PHP, Python, etc., le contenu correspondant peut être extrait de la base de données et des pages HTML dynamiques peuvent être générées selon les préférences linguistiques de l'utilisateur.
Alors, quelle est la relation entre la génération multilingue de fichiers HTML et le domaine mobile ? Prenons comme exemple la mise à jour du système Android proposée par Google pour les appareils Pixel. Avec la popularité des smartphones dans le monde entier, la demande des utilisateurs en matière de localisation et de prise en charge multilingue augmente. Une excellente application mobile ou interface système doit être capable de fournir un affichage dans la langue correspondante en fonction de la région et des paramètres linguistiques de l'utilisateur. Cela nécessite que la page frontale de l'application, c'est-à-dire la partie construite sur la base de HTML ou de technologies similaires, dispose de fortes capacités de génération multilingue.
Par exemple, si une application de médias sociaux populaire souhaite gagner une base d’utilisateurs plus large dans le monde entier, elle doit s’assurer que son interface peut représenter avec précision le contenu dans plusieurs langues. Qu'il s'agisse d'actualités, de commentaires d'utilisateurs ou de menus de fonctions, ils doivent tous être ajustés de manière adaptative en fonction des préférences linguistiques de l'utilisateur. La mise en œuvre technique derrière cela repose fortement sur la capacité de génération multilingue des fichiers HTML.
En outre, la conception réactive des fichiers HTML est également cruciale, compte tenu des différentes tailles d'écran et résolutions des appareils mobiles. La génération multilingue ne consiste pas seulement à convertir le contenu du texte, mais doit également garantir que la mise en page peut maintenir une bonne lisibilité et convivialité dans différentes langues. Grâce à l'utilisation flexible des requêtes multimédias CSS et à une technologie de mise en page flexible, il est possible d'obtenir un affichage adaptatif des pages sur différents appareils et environnements linguistiques.
D’un autre côté, la génération multilingue de fichiers HTML a également un impact sur les performances et l’expérience utilisateur des applications mobiles. Le chargement d'une trop grande quantité de données de version linguistique peut ralentir le chargement des pages. Une optimisation de la compression des données, des stratégies de mise en cache et du chargement asynchrone est donc nécessaire. Dans le même temps, afin de garantir que les utilisateurs puissent fonctionner sans problème lors du changement de langue, il est également nécessaire de concevoir des mécanismes de changement de langue et des effets de transition efficaces.
Bref, même si la génération multilingue de fichiers HTML semble être un domaine technique plus professionnel, elle joue un rôle indispensable dans le développement du domaine mobile. Avec l'avancement continu de la technologie et l'évolution des besoins des utilisateurs, nous avons des raisons de croire que ce domaine continuera à innover et à s'améliorer à l'avenir, nous apportant une expérience mobile plus pratique et de haute qualité.